Statement to voters
Cahal Burke is a very well known campaigner who lives in the heart of Lindley ward and works at Kirklees College. Cahal is know as a champion of the Lindley community. He has worked tirelessly with local people to establish popular community events. For example the Lindley 10K and the Lindley Carnival. Cahal keeps local residents in touch through a regular FOCUS newsletter that enables people to let ask Cahal for help and support in many different ways. Cahal holds regular councillor help and advice surgeries and has helped many hundreds of local people with their problems. Cahal has been very active in fought changes to HRI for over 15 years! Firstly, when a Labour Government down graded the Maternity unit and began the series of attempts by Government to reduce the HRI to a cottage hospital which is totally unsuitable and unacceptable to Huddersfield and the Colne Valley. Cahal is a determined campaigner speaking up for the people he represents. He has constantly raised concerns about the lack of primary school places in the area despite Kirklees Labour agreeing to the building of hundreds of more houses. The Labour solution is for children to go to less popular schools elsewhere in Huddersfield. Potholed roads is one of the constant complaints Cahal receives from local people. The Lib Dems proposed an extra £1m for repairs but Labour refused to agree. Kirklees Labour has planned to increase car parking charges and for on street parking in Huddersfield. On top of this there are plans to impose charges on the Lidget Street car park in Lindley. And beware of driving in bus lanes as the Council hopes to increase its income by £750,000 from fines! Cahal Burke is a very active campaigner who puts the needs of local people first.
Election history
Westminster general elections
| Election | Constituency | Party | Votes | Rank | Link |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| Scunthorpe | Liberal Democrats | 942 | 6 | soundex |
| 2019 | Colne Valley | Liberal Democrats | 3,815 | 3 | soundex |
| 2017 | Colne Valley | Liberal Democrats | 2,494 | 3 | soundex |
| 2015 | Colne Valley | Liberal Democrats | 3,407 | 4 | soundex |
